if (document.documentElement.clientWidth > 600) {//頁面寬度大於600px讓其寬度等於600px,字體大小等於60px,居中 document.documentElement.style.width = "600px ...
if (document.documentElement.clientWidth > 600) {//頁面寬度大於600px讓其寬度等於600px,字體大小等於60px,居中 document.documentElement.style.width = "600px ...
問題:手機端項目在華為的某款手機上顯示時頁面內容沒有自適應手機寬度,出現橫向滾動條 原因:手機獲取手機屏幕寬度並計算出rem時出現偏差,明顯寬余真實手機屏寬度 解決方案一:在頁面里獲取頁面最外層dom的寬度即html的寬度與手機屏幕的寬度對比,如果兩者不等,直接給html的font-size ...
一個是依賴父元素計算。 2,為什么要使用rem rem可以實現強大的屏幕適配布局。屏幕適配有很 ...
rem 量圖計算公式: 獲取比值:設備尺寸/設計圖尺寸 例如:設備寬度尺寸為 375px 、設計圖尺寸為750px,計算獲得比值為0.5,量得設計圖上某個圖片元素寬度為 100px,實際在375px寬度的設備上此元素為 100 * 0.5 = 50 px。 故: 設置html 下 ...
網頁可見區域寬: document.body.clientWidth 網頁可見區域高: document.body.clientHeight 網頁可見區域寬: document.body ...
document.write("屏幕分辨率為:"+screen.width+"*"+screen.height+"<br />"+"屏幕可用大小:"+screen.availWidth+"*"+screen.availHeight+"<br />"+"網頁可見區域寬 ...
一、前言 我們在編寫網頁時,往往需要兼顧網頁在不同屏寬情況下的顯示 而有時為了省事,沒時間寫新的頁面,也為了兼容考慮,這就需要使用等比壓縮了 等比壓縮的核心是rem 二、正文 (一)、rem的使用 rem是css3中新增加的一個單位屬性(font size ...
方式1 利用canvas處理 方式2 利用頁面控件處理 ...